• ベストアンサー

今までWinXPのPCにてVB6とAccess2000を用いた

今までWinXPのPCにてVB6とAccess2000を用いた システムを使っていました。 しかし、パソコンを入れ替えることになり、OSを7にしたら Accessの2000は対応していないとのことで システムを動かすことが出来ません。 現在までにXPモードで動かす機能があるということは分っていますが、 その他にこの環境で動かす方法はないのでしょうか? お分かりになる方がいましたらご伝授の程、宜しくお願いします。

質問者が選んだベストアンサー

  • ベストアンサー
  • FEX2053
  • ベストアンサー率37% (7991/21371)
回答No.1

VB6はWindows7でもサポートされる、とのことです。 http://msdn.microsoft.com/ja-jp/vbasic/cc707268.aspx Access2000のVBAコードは、複雑な処理さえしてなければ、Access2007 でも「一応はそのまま」動作します。動作しない場合も、大概は「引数 の設定変更」によるものなので、特段ロジックを精緻に追わなくても 書き換えは可能ですから、VBAに慣れたプログラマなら難しい作業じゃ ありません(面倒な作業ではありますが)。 XPモードにするより、素直にOffice2007にしちゃった方が良いと思い ますよ。Access2000は、私の知る限りで、Windows3.1用のAccess2.0に 次いで不安定なAccessですので。

bay25
質問者

お礼

早速の回答ありがとうございました。 しかし、無謀だと思われるかもしれませんが XPモードでもなく、Office2007にするでもなく 動かす方法を模索している最中なのです(汗) けど、仮にOffice2007を入れるとした際、 データの引き継ぎ等が上手く行くのかも悩みの種だったので ほぼ問題無さそうなので安心しました。 もう少し別の方法と格闘した上で購入を検討したいと思います。

関連するQ&A